Fall in house sales during 2011

by isleofman.com 1st September 2011

There is bad news from the Manx government for people who are trying to sell properties, with a dramatic fall in the number of transactions.

This year, provisional figures from the Council of Ministers show almost 650 houses in the Isle of Man have been sold, compared to more than 1,500 three years ago.

It's even worse for flat owners, with 137 sales in the past year compared to almost 400 in 2008.

The quarterly economic report also shows the average price of an apartment has dropped by more than ?10,000 since last June.
